Blue Jean transfer and Leatherique

by | December 19th, 2011 | Ask-a-Pro Comment(s)Comments (23)

If you have light colored leather in your car, then chances are that you’ve experienced blue dye transfer from your jeans where they seem to stain the leather. Greg Nichols of Reflections Detailing offers up some advice on how to properly clean this up using the least aggressive methods.
